Thromboelastography in Dogs with Chronic Hepatopathies.
W Fry1, C Lester2, N M Etedali3
1Massachusetts Veterinary Referral Hospital, Woburn, MA.
Journal of Veterinary Internal Medicine
|January 19, 2017
Summary
Thromboelastography (TEG) reveals variable coagulation in dogs with chronic hepatopathies (CH). Hypocoagulable TEG parameters indicate a negative prognosis, while hyperfibrinolysis suggests high disease activity.
Area of Science:
- Veterinary Medicine
- Hematology
- Internal Medicine
Background:
- Coagulation status in dogs with liver disease is challenging to predict using traditional tests.
- Chronic hepatopathies (CH) significantly impact canine health and hemostasis.
Purpose of the Study:
- To assess thromboelastography (TEG) findings in dogs with CH.
- To correlate TEG results with conventional coagulation tests and disease severity indicators.
Main Methods:
- Prospective and retrospective enrollment of 21 dogs with CH.
- Kaolin-activated TEG analysis and comparison with reference intervals.
- Correlation analysis of TEG parameters with coagulation assays and clinicopathologic data.
Main Results:
- Dogs with CH exhibited altered TEG parameters, including prolonged R and K times, increased LY30, and decreased angles.
- TEG results varied, categorizing dogs as normocoagulable, hypercoagulable, or hypocoagulable.
- Specific TEG parameters correlated significantly with fibrinogen, PT, aPTT, protein C activity, and clinical scores.
- Hyperfibrinolysis (elevated LY30) was linked to higher serum transaminase activities.
- Portal hypertension correlated with hypocoagulable TEG patterns and prolonged PT.
Conclusions:
- Thromboelastography demonstrates diverse coagulation profiles in dogs with chronic hepatopathies.
- Hypocoagulable TEG parameters serve as negative prognostic indicators in canine CH.
- Hyperfibrinolysis identified by TEG is associated with heightened disease activity in dogs with CH.
